  1. Dictionary
    Re·or·der
    /rēˈôrdər/

    verb

    • 1. request (something) to be made, supplied, or served again: "the most popular toys will be reordered immediately"
    • 2. arrange (something) again: "he fixed his bed and reordered his books"

    noun

    • 1. a renewed or repeated order for goods.
